Educational Assistance – Books for Africa
The Life for Children Ministry has a new library which we are excited to support by purchasing approximately 1700 books for the students. We wholeheartedly believe in their motto, “Today a reader, tomorrow a leader.”


Nutritional Support
As a part of our nutrition initiative, the JMF purchased a greenhouse for a group of hardworking Kenyan widows called the “Jewels of Obaga”, a widow mentoring organization. We were prompted to sponsor this project after hearing the poignant and heartbreaking realities of cultural oppression they face in Kenya. We look forward to sharing the rewards from investing in their lives through these and future sustainable nutritional programs.

Home Builds
We are pleased to announce that our co-sponsorship of Habitat for Humanity homes will double this year! As our partnership aided in the completion of two homes in 2021, we feel privileged to be a part of something that greatly blesses so many families in need. Additionally, the JMF is thrilled about the ongoing success of our Kenyan home build initiative with the Life for Children Ministry, committing to sponsoring the build of a minimum of 4 homes by year end.
Educational Assistance - JMF “Making A Difference” Scholarship

To date, 60% of our $25K scholarship goal has been met, and there are 24 students who have expressed interest in applying this year. On February 6, we sponsored an essay writing workshop for the candidates focusing on how to tell your story and write a winning essay. A big shout out of thanks to Ms. Tanika Mangum of Paid4College for facilitating a well-received, high-energy session. It is important to provide these kinds of opportunities, and we thank you in advance for the continual generosity that will allow us to meet and prayerfully, exceed the JMF “Making A Difference” Scholarship goal.
